The 2011 joplin tornado was a catastrophic ef5rated multiplevortex tornado that struck joplin, missouri, late in the afternoon of sunday, may 22, 2011. Jane cage, chairman of the joplin citizens advisory team cart, compiled and collected these essays as a way for the joplin community to pay it forward in recognition of the almost 200,000 volunteers that came to help their city in the two years since the devastating tornado.
